Homemade Yum Yum Sauce Recipe
This homemade yum yum sauce recipe makes an irresistible condiment you'll love putting on grilled meats, seafood, noodles, and more! This tangy sauce needs only a few ingredients and 5 minutes of prep.

-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tbsp ketchup
- 1 tsp sugar
- 1/2 tsp paprika
- 2 tsp seasoned rice vinegar
- 2 tsp garlic powder
- 1 - 4 tsp water as needed
Add all of the ingredients to a medium mixing bowl, except for the water. Add 1 tbsp of water and whisk it all together until evenly combined & smooth.

Add more water, if needed, to thin the sauce to your desired consistency- if needed.
Cover and chill for 1-2 hours in the refrigerator before serving.
- Add the water a little bit at a time so you are sure the sauce will be the right consistency. Adding too much at once can lead to sauce that is too thin.
- Give the sauce a taste before serving and adjust the seasonings as needed.
- Let the sauce rest in the fridge. It needs the time for all the flavors to meld.
